Unbounded Love Card Measurements:

  • 4-1/4″ x 11″ Summer Splash Cardstock
  • 4″ x 6″ Unbounded Beauty 12″ x 12″ Designer Series Paper torn or cut at approximately 1-3/4″
  • 3″ x 2″ Basic White Cardstock
  • 4″ x 5-1/4″ Basic White Cardstock (inside)
